#include <avr/io.h> 
#include <avr/delay.h>  
#include "english.h"
#include "write.h"
#include "move.h"



#define LCD_DC                 0x01  //  PB0
#define LCD_CE                 0x04  //  PB2
#define SPI_MOSI               0x08  //  PB3
#define LCD_RST                0x10  //  PB4
#define SPI_CLK                0x20  //  PB5


void LCD_init(void);
void LCD_clear(void);
void display_one_char(unsigned char x,unsigned char y,unsigned char char_data);
void LCD_write_english_string(unsigned char X,unsigned char Y,char *s);
void LCD_write_chinese_string(unsigned char X, unsigned char Y, unsigned char ch_with,unsigned char num,unsigned char line,unsigned char row);
void LCD_move_chinese_string(unsigned char X, unsigned char Y, unsigned char T);                 
void LCD_write_char(unsigned char c);
void LCD_draw_bmp_pixel(unsigned char X,unsigned char Y,unsigned char *map,unsigned char Pix_x,unsigned char Pix_y);                  
void LCD_write_byte(unsigned char data, unsigned char dc);
void delay_1us(void);                 
void delay_nus(unsigned int n);      
void delay_1ms(void);                
void delay_nms(unsigned int n);  





/*-----------------------------------------------------------------------
延时函数
系统时钟:8M
-----------------------------------------------------------------------*/
void delay_1us(void)                 //1us延时函数
  {
   asm("nop");
  }

void delay_nus(unsigned int n)       //N us延时函数
  {
   unsigned int i=0;
   for (i=0;i<n;i++)
   delay_1us();
  }
  
void delay_1ms(void)                 //1ms延时函数
  {
   unsigned int i;
   for (i=0;i<1140;i++);
  }
  
void delay_nms(unsigned int n)       //N ms延时函数
  {
   unsigned int i=0;
   for (i=0;i<n;i++)
   delay_1ms();
  }
/*-----------------------------------------------------------------------
LCD_init          : 3310LCD初始化

编写日期          :2004-8-10 
最后修改日期      :2004-8-10 
-----------------------------------------------------------------------*/
void LCD_init(void)
  {
    PORTB &= ~LCD_RST;          // 产生一个让LCD复位的低电平脉冲
    delay_1us();
    PORTB |= LCD_RST;
    
    PORTB &= ~LCD_CE ;		// 关闭LCD
    delay_1us();
    PORTB |= LCD_CE;		// 使能LCD
    delay_1us();

    LCD_write_byte(0x21, 0);	// 使用扩展命令设置LCD模式
    LCD_write_byte(0xc8, 0);	// 设置偏置电压
    LCD_write_byte(0x06, 0);	// 温度校正
    LCD_write_byte(0x13, 0);	// 1:48
    LCD_write_byte(0x20, 0);	// 使用基本命令
    LCD_clear();	        // 清屏
    LCD_write_byte(0x0c, 0);	// 设定显示模式,正常显示
        
    PORTB &= ~LCD_CE ;          // 关闭LCD

	LCD_clear();
  }

/*-----------------------------------------------------------------------
LCD_clear         : LCD清屏函数

编写日期          :2004-8-10 
最后修改日期      :2004-8-10 
-----------------------------------------------------------------------*/
void LCD_clear(void)
  {
    unsigned int i;

    LCD_write_byte(0x0c, 0);			
    LCD_write_byte(0x80, 0);			

    for (i=0; i<504; i++)
      LCD_write_byte(0, 1);			
  }

/*-----------------------------------------------------------------------
LCD_set_XY        : 设置LCD坐标函数

输入参数:X       :0-83
          Y       :0-5

编写日期          :2004-8-10 
最后修改日期      :2004-8-10 
-----------------------------------------------------------------------*/
void LCD_set_XY(unsigned char X, unsigned char Y)
  {
    LCD_write_byte(0x40 | Y, 0);		// column
    LCD_write_byte(0x80 | X, 0);          	// row
  }

/*-----------------------------------------------------------------------
LCD_write_char    : 显示英文字符

输入参数:c       :显示的字符;

编写日期          :2004-8-10 
最后修改日期      :2004-8-10 
-----------------------------------------------------------------------*/
void LCD_write_char(unsigned char c)
  {
    unsigned char line;

    c -= 32;

    for (line=0; line<6; line++)
      LCD_write_byte(font6x8[c][line], 1);
  }


/*-----------------------------------------------------------------------
LCD_write_char           : 指定位置显示单个英文字符

输入参数:char_data      :显示的字符;

编写日期                 :2004-8-10 
最后修改日期             :2004-8-10 
-----------------------------------------------------------------------*/
void display_one_char(unsigned char x,unsigned char y,unsigned char char_data)
{
unsigned char i;
LCD_set_XY(x*6,y);
char_data-=32;
/*
for(TempCyc = 0; (ASC[TempCyc][0]!=char_data)&&(TempCyc<80); TempCyc++); //查表显示
if (ASC[TempCyc][0] == char_data)
{
*/
for (i=0;i<6;i++)
{

LCD_write_byte(font6x8[char_data][i],1); 

}
LCD_write_byte(0,1);

}




/*-----------------------------------------------------------------------
LCD_write_english_String  : 英文字符串显示函数

输入参数:*s      :英文字符串指针;
          X、Y    : 显示字符串的位置,x 0-83 ,y 0-5

编写日期          :2004-8-10 
最后修改日期      :2004-8-10 		
-----------------------------------------------------------------------*/
void LCD_write_english_string(unsigned char X,unsigned char Y,char *s)
  {
    LCD_set_XY(X,Y);
    while (*s) 
      {
	 LCD_write_char(*s);
	 s++;
      }
  }
/*-----------------------------------------------------------------------
LCD_write_chinese_string: 在LCD上显示汉字

输入参数:X、Y    :显示汉字的起始X、Y坐标;
          ch_with :汉字点阵的宽度
          num     :显示汉字的个数;  
          line    :汉字点阵数组中的起始行数
          row     :汉字显示的行间距
编写日期          :2004-8-11 
最后修改日期      :2004-8-12 
测试:
	LCD_write_chi(0,0,12,7,0,0);
	LCD_write_chi(0,2,12,7,0,0);
	LCD_write_chi(0,4,12,7,0,0);	
----------------------------------------------------------------------- */                       
void LCD_write_chinese_string(unsigned char X, unsigned char Y, 
                   unsigned char ch_with,unsigned char num,
                   unsigned char line,unsigned char row)
  {
    unsigned char i,n;
    
    LCD_set_XY(X,Y);                             //设置初始位置
    
    for (i=0;i<num;)
      {
      	for (n=0; n<ch_with*2; n++)              //写一个汉字
      	  { 
      	    if (n==ch_with)                      //写汉字的下半部分
      	      {
      	        if (i==0) LCD_set_XY(X,Y+1);
      	        else
      	           LCD_set_XY((X+(ch_with+row)*i),Y+1);
              }
      	    LCD_write_byte(write_chinese_string[line+i][n],1);
      	  }
      	i++;
      	LCD_set_XY((X+(ch_with+row)*i),Y);
      }
  }
  

/*-----------------------------------------------------------------------
LCD_move_chinese_string: 汉字移动

输入参数:X、Y    :显示汉字的起始X、Y坐标;
          T       :移动速度;

编写日期          :2004-8-13 
最后修改日期      :2004-8-13 
----------------------------------------------------------------------- */                       
void LCD_move_chinese_string (unsigned char X, unsigned char Y, unsigned char T)
  {
    unsigned char i,n,j=0;
    unsigned char buffer_h[84]={0};
    unsigned char buffer_l[84]={0};
      
    for (i=0; i<156; i++)
      {
        buffer_h[83] = move_chinese_string[i/12][j];
        buffer_l[83] = move_chinese_string[i/12][j+12];
        j++;
        if (j==12) j=0;
        
        for (n=0; n<83; n++)
          { 
            buffer_h[n]=buffer_h[n+1];
            buffer_l[n]=buffer_l[n+1];
          } 
        
        LCD_set_XY(X,Y);
        for (n=0; n<83; n++)
          { 
            LCD_write_byte(buffer_h[n],1);
          } 
        
        LCD_set_XY(X,Y+1); 
        for (n=0; n<83; n++)
          { 
            LCD_write_byte(buffer_l[n],1);
          } 
          
       delay_nms(T);
      }
  }



/*-----------------------------------------------------------------------
LCD_draw_map      : 位图绘制函数

输入参数:X、Y    :位图绘制的起始X、Y坐标;
          *map    :位图点阵数据;
          Pix_x   :位图像素(长)
          Pix_y   :位图像素(宽)

编写日期          :2004-8-13
最后修改日期      :2004-8-13 
-----------------------------------------------------------------------*/
void LCD_draw_bmp_pixel(unsigned char X,unsigned char Y,unsigned char *map,
                  unsigned char Pix_x,unsigned char Pix_y)
  {
    unsigned int i,n;
    unsigned char row;
    
    if (Pix_y%8==0) row=Pix_y/8;      //计算位图所占行数
      else
        row=Pix_y/8+1;
    
    for (n=0;n<row;n++)
      {
      	LCD_set_XY(X,Y);
        for(i=0; i<Pix_x; i++)
          {
            LCD_write_byte(map[i+n*Pix_x], 1);
          }
        Y++;                         //换行
      }      
  }

/*-----------------------------------------------------------------------
LCD_write_byte    : 使用SPI接口写数据到LCD

输入参数:data    :写入的数据;
          command :写数据/命令选择;

编写日期          :2004-8-10 
最后修改日期      :2004-8-13 
-----------------------------------------------------------------------*/
void LCD_write_byte(unsigned char data, unsigned char command)
  {
    PORTB &= ~LCD_CE ;		        // 使能LCD
    
    if (command == 0)
      PORTB &= ~LCD_DC ;	        // 传送命令
    else
      PORTB |= LCD_DC ;		        // 传送数据

    SPDR = data;			// 传送数据到SPI寄存器

    while ((SPSR & 0x80) == 0);         // 等待数据传送完毕
	
    PORTB |= LCD_CE ;			// 关闭LCD
  }
